Study On Transportation Safety Of Liquefied Natural Gas Road Tanker

In recent years,with the rapid development of social economy,the demand for liquefied natural gas as clean energy increases sharply,which increases its transportation volume.The road tanker as the best transport tool for transporting liquid goods is widely applied.Liquefied natural gas is a dangerous goods with low temperature,high pressure,inflammable and explosive characteristics.If there is a slight carelessness in transportation,accidents will cause bad effects to the society.Therefore,research on transportation safety of liquefied natural gas highway tanker is of great practical significance for reducing its transport accidents,improving transport efficiency and widely application and development of liquefied natural gas.The main contents of this paper are as the following aspects:First,starting from the structure of liquefied natural gas and chemical properties of highway transportation of liquefied natural gas tanker safety hazard analysis,liquefied natural gas and tanker itself,and analyzing the main factors affecting the transportation safety of liquefied natural gas tanker road from three aspects of human.Secondly,through the statistical analysis of liquefied natural gas tanker transportation accident occurred nearly five years on the road,the main types of accidents of liquefied natural gas tanker transportation highway is a natural gas leak,and the tank liquid flow and tank running state changes in the lateral and longitudinal stability reduce tanker rollover is the main lure causes of leakage.Thirdly,on the sloshing impact of liquid,the dynamic characteristics of the liquid in the tank of a liquefied natural gas tanker in the course of transportation are investigated.From the perspective of the theory of fluid dynamics,boundary conditions for the whole process analysis of the impact of the tank liquid sloshing in the tank in the process of the need of basic equations and solving the fluid dynamics satisfied;then the numerical simulation method and the Fluent simulation software and the solving process are introduced,it constructed the liquefied natural gas transportation tank simulation process of the numerical model.Finally,simulation of Tank Simulation of transportation of liquefied natural gas in the lateral impact of liquid sloshing on the acceleration and filling rate when the vehicle turns the different by Fluent software were analyzed,and then puts forward the relevant suggestions on the transportation safety theory.The simulation results show that: when the tank filling rate is constant,the lateral sloshing of liquid in tank on the impact of the steering acceleration(0.1g-0.5g)increases,but the overall stress in 0.5g direction to the side of the possibility of a larger,there may be side turn.When the steering acceleration is constant,the lateral impact force of tank sloshing on tank will increase with the increase of filling rate when filling rate is 0.6-0.85,while 0.85-0.9will decrease with the increase of filling rate.It can be seen that when the filling rate is between 0.85-0.9 and the steering acceleration of 0.1-0.4g,the safety of the tank car is relatively high when it turns.
